Task Queue

Description: The task queue is a fundamental data structure in task management within distributed systems. Its main function is to store and organize pending tasks that need to be processed, allowing systems to handle multiple requests efficiently and scalably. In the context of cloud computing, where resources are dynamically allocated based on demand, task queues enable the decoupling of task generation from their processing. This means that applications can continue to operate without interruptions, even during load spikes. Task queues are particularly useful in environments requiring high availability and resilience, as they allow for automatic retries and ensure that tasks are processed in the correct order. Additionally, they facilitate the implementation of design patterns such as producer-consumer, where one component generates tasks and another consumes them, optimizing resource usage and improving overall system efficiency. In summary, the task queue is an essential tool for workflow management in modern applications, especially in distributed architectures where flexibility and scalability are crucial.

  • Rating:
  • 3
  • (5)

Deja tu comentario

Your email address will not be published. Required fields are marked *

PATROCINADORES

Glosarix on your device

Install
×
Enable Notifications Ok No